Research and Reference Services
The Foley Public Library provides patrons with access to a wealth of research and reference materials, including online databases, genealogy resources, and interlibrary loan services. The library’s knowledgeable staff are always on hand to offer guidance and support, helping patrons to navigate the vast array of resources available and find the information they need. Whether you’re a student working on a research project, a genealogist tracing your family history, or simply looking for information on a particular topic, the Foley Public Library has the tools and expertise to help you achieve your goals.
Service | Description |
---|---|
Online Databases | Access to a range of online databases, including JSTOR, EBSCO, and ProQuest |
Genealogy Resources | Access to genealogy databases, including Ancestry.com and HeritageQuest |
Interlibrary Loan | Ability to borrow materials from other libraries through the interlibrary loan service |

Children’s Services
The Foley Public Library is dedicated to providing a range of services and resources specifically designed for children. The library’s children’s collection includes a vast array of books, audiobooks, and DVDs, as well as online resources and databases tailored to children’s needs. The library also offers a range of programs and events for children, including storytime, summer reading programs, and craft activities.
- Children's storytime: weekly sessions for children aged 0-5 years
- Summer reading programs: annual programs designed to promote literacy and a love of reading in children
- Craft activities: regular sessions where children can engage in creative activities and make new friends
